titleOfInvention 3D flexible bag to be filled with biopharmaceutical fluid and method of making such bag
abstract The 3-D flexible bag (1) to be filled with biopharmaceutical products is the result of assembling two wall elements (2, 3) and two liners (11, 12). At least one connection port (4, 6) is also provided for filling and/or emptying. Due to the unfolding of the gusset in combination with the folding of the flaps (21, 22, 31, 32) of the two wall elements, a substantially parallelepiped configuration is obtained in the filled state. A transverse weld (140, 150) formed at one end joins the two wall elements (2, 3) of the bag and extends continuously, keeping the following in the folded flat state: - Elongation of a gusset (11) edge; - the elongated edge of the other gusset (12). The transverse weld has a length corresponding to the determined dimension (L2) of the flexible bag in the parallelepiped configuration.
